repooc Posted March 18, 2014 Author Report Share Posted March 18, 2014 Did you have air leaks or rain leaks?Lol both and the accordion boot. the threaded inserts leaked down the threads of the bolts and one around the riveted section. I thread sealed the bolts and sealed around all inserts. The accordion boot did not get the silicone love it should have. pulled it off, cleaned it and filled it with silicone,put it on and water tested. the air leaks where a pain to find but I did and filled with silicone an some Great Stuff for the front of the box (my bed front is all bent up because I'm an asshole to my trucks lol).
